/**
* A {@link android.widget.FrameLayout} that contains an icon and a {@link BubbleTextView} for text.
* This lets us animate the child BubbleTextView's background (transparent ripple) separately from
* the {@link DeepShortcutView} background color.
*/
public class DeepShortcutView extends FrameLayout implements BubbleTextHolder {
private static final Point sTempPoint = new Point();
private final Drawable mTransparentDrawable = new ColorDrawable(Color.TRANSPARENT);
private BubbleTextView mBubbleText;
private View mIconView;
private WorkspaceItemInfo mInfo;
private ShortcutInfo mDetail;
public DeepShortcutView(Context context) {
this(context, null, 0);
}
public DeepShortcutView(Context context, AttributeSet attrs) {
this(context, attrs, 0);
}
public DeepShortcutView(Context context, AttributeSet attrs, int defStyle) {
super(context, attrs, defStyle);
}
@Override
protected void onFinishInflate() {
super.onFinishInflate();
mBubbleText = findViewById(R.id.bubble_text);
mBubbleText.setHideBadge(true);
mIconView = findViewById(R.id.icon);
tryUpdateTextBackground();
}
@Override
public void setBackground(Drawable background) {
super.setBackground(background);
tryUpdateTextBackground();
}
@Override
public void setBackgroundResource(int resid) {
super.setBackgroundResource(resid);
tryUpdateTextBackground();
}
/**
* Updates the text background to match the shape of this background (when applicable).
*/
private void tryUpdateTextBackground() {
if (!(getBackground() instanceof GradientDrawable) || mBubbleText == null) {
return;
}
GradientDrawable background = (GradientDrawable) getBackground();
int color = Themes.getAttrColor(getContext(), android.R.attr.colorControlHighlight);
GradientDrawable backgroundMask = new GradientDrawable();
backgroundMask.setColor(color);
backgroundMask.setShape(GradientDrawable.RECTANGLE);
if (background.getCornerRadii() != null) {
backgroundMask.setCornerRadii(background.getCornerRadii());
} else {
backgroundMask.setCornerRadius(background.getCornerRadius());
}
RippleDrawable drawable = new RippleDrawable(ColorStateList.valueOf(color),
mTransparentDrawable, backgroundMask);
mBubbleText.setBackground(drawable);
}

/**
* Returns the position of the center of the icon relative to the container.
*/
public Point getIconCenter() {
sTempPoint.y = sTempPoint.x = getMeasuredHeight() / 2;
if (Utilities.isRtl(getResources())) {
sTempPoint.x = getMeasuredWidth() - sTempPoint.x;
}
return sTempPoint;
}
/** package private **/
public void applyShortcutInfo(WorkspaceItemInfo info, ShortcutInfo detail,
PopupContainerWithArrow container) {
mInfo = info;
mDetail = detail;
mBubbleText.applyFromWorkspaceItem(info);
mIconView.setBackground(mBubbleText.getIcon());
// Use the long label as long as it exists and fits.
CharSequence longLabel = mDetail.getLongLabel();
int availableWidth = mBubbleText.getWidth() - mBubbleText.getTotalPaddingLeft()
- mBubbleText.getTotalPaddingRight();
boolean usingLongLabel = !TextUtils.isEmpty(longLabel)
&& mBubbleText.getPaint().measureText(longLabel.toString()) <= availableWidth;
mBubbleText.setText(usingLongLabel ? longLabel : mDetail.getShortLabel());
// TODO: Add the click handler to this view directly and not the child view.
mBubbleText.setOnClickListener(container.getItemClickListener());
mBubbleText.setOnLongClickListener(container.getItemDragHandler());
mBubbleText.setOnTouchListener(container.getItemDragHandler());
}
